1
0
Fork 0
mirror of https://github.com/ruby/ruby.git synced 2022-11-09 12:17:21 -05:00

* gc.c (gc_profile_record_get): to static function.

(gc_profile_result): ditto.
  (gc_profile_report): ditto.



git-svn-id: svn+ssh://ci.ruby-lang.org/ruby/trunk@19125 b2dd03c8-39d4-4d8f-98ff-823fe69b080e
This commit is contained in:
nari 2008-09-04 10:47:39 +00:00
parent 49e9f42703
commit c56ef25cf9
2 changed files with 11 additions and 4 deletions

View file

@ -1,3 +1,9 @@
Thu Sep 4 19:40:50 2008 Narihiro Nakamura <authorNari@gmail.com>
* gc.c (gc_profile_record_get): to static function.
(gc_profile_result): ditto.
(gc_profile_report): ditto.
Thu Sep 4 19:20:24 2008 Tanaka Akira <akr@fsij.org>
* include/ruby/io.h (rb_io_enc_t): rename flags to ecflags.

9
gc.c
View file

@ -2682,7 +2682,7 @@ gc_malloc_allocations(VALUE self)
}
#endif
VALUE
static VALUE
gc_profile_record_get(void)
{
VALUE prof;
@ -2729,14 +2729,15 @@ gc_profile_record_get(void)
* 1 0.012 159240 212940 10647 0.00000000000001530000
*/
VALUE
static VALUE
gc_profile_result(void)
{
rb_objspace_t *objspace = &rb_objspace;
VALUE record = gc_profile_record_get();
VALUE record;
VALUE result;
int i;
record = gc_profile_record_get();
if (objspace->profile.run && objspace->profile.count) {
result = rb_sprintf("GC %d invokes.\n", NUM2INT(gc_count(0)));
rb_str_cat2(result, "Index Invoke Time(sec) Use Size(byte) Total Size(byte) Total Object GC Time(ms)\n");
@ -2780,7 +2781,7 @@ gc_profile_result(void)
*
*/
VALUE
static VALUE
gc_profile_report(int argc, VALUE *argv, VALUE self)
{
VALUE out;